The Shark Detect Pro is a premium self-emptying robot vacuum featuring 3 advanced cleaning technologies that sense dirt, floor types, and edges for superior debris pickup. Its NeverStuck technology ensures obstacle navigation and threshold climbing for uninterrupted cleaning. With a 30-day bagless base equipped with HEPA filtration, it traps 99.97% of allergens, making it ideal for pet owners and allergy sufferers. WiFi and voice control integration allow for convenient scheduling and targeted cleaning, delivering a hands-free, deep-clean experience on carpets and hard floors.

I originally tried a Roomba j8+ which was a decent option, but it had various quirks that I wasn't happy with, such as getting "lost" under the bed and ignoring keep-out zones. I like the Shark brand and based on the good reviews, decided to give this one a try. The lidar enables this to map my home in under 10min vs. over an hour with the Roomba. And I needed some type of obstacle avoidance in case it runs across a dog "mess" that I haven't had a chance to clean it up. I hope to not have to test that, but it does avoid dog toys without issue. I also have several thin area rugs that bunch up easily, but this vacuum easily climbs over them. It will actually climb over lots of things because of it's "Neverstuck" feature, so you should probably supervise it for it's first cleaning. The downsides are minimal, especially for this price point. First, the single side brush only spins on hard surfaces -- whether it's due to a weak motor or some undocumented feature is unclear, but it's been mentioned by others online. Second, the Android app is rather barebones. You can only schedule a full house cleaning, not specific rooms. It's unclear at this time if Shark ever pushes firmware updates to the vacuum to increase performance or add features to the Android app. UPDATE 8/15/24: it does not avoid dog feces, even in well-lit conditions. Every component underneath was soiled. It took hours to disassemble everything I could and scrub/clean. It's not built to be cleaned in situations like this, and that part of the design could be improved. Luckily once it was all put back together it works fine; but I am no longer cleaning on a schedule and instead will trigger cleanings daily after first inspecting my floor.

The first time I tried to set it up, it wouldn't connect to wifi. Told me to restart my phone and reset my router. I restarted my phone, but decided to try it again before restarting my router and it worked. Let it map the house, which seemed to go well. Assigning rooms was tricky and imprecise because the app won't let you adjust the width down unless you continuously enlarge the scale of the map. Scheduled a cleaning for the whole house, and it took off and seemed to navigate well and never got stuck anywhere. Very quiet. But with about 70% battery left, it came back to base. I was pretty sure it couldn't have finished - but how would I know unless I followed it around? The app doesn't show you a track of where it went like my Wyze vaccuum did. But all it did was empty the dust bin and take off to clean some more. When it was down to about 7% battery, it came back and docked. I wasn't sure if it was done or not. About 4 hours later, sure enough, it took off. At that point I knew I wouldn't be able to deal with not knowing where it had been and how much it had cleaned. I initiated a return and the unit is all boxed up and ready to go back. It's really a shame that SharkNinja has such great products but such a lousy app to go with those products.
